Chapter 11: Overheard
Xionâs friends were not as eager to take part in his idea as he was, but they did all eventually agree. Ava thought that he was being stupid, but she refused to let him do it on his own. Sapphire agreed to help, but not to take part herself. Warren also agreed, but he was not eager to put himself in any danger.
Xion wanted to immediately search for whatever was attacking, but Sapphire insisted that they gather more information first. Warren pointed out that Ustama was mostly empty space and for anything to reach them would take days or weeks. To Xionâs disappointment, he agreed to gather information, he just hoped they could do it all before Aurâin was attacked.
First, Xion was going to need to find out exactly what was coming. âThe green onesâ was probably not the official name. Xion guessed that it was just what the dragon called whatever it was.
Warren was good with studying up and reading through books, so he agreed to do some research and try to find out more. Sapphire was helping him, as she was not comfortable with the other part of the plan. Xion and Ava had agreed to do the part that actually might get them into trouble.
Xion knew that there was something coming to the city, and he knew that someone inside the city had orchestrated it all. He was determined to stop whatever it was, but he needed to know more. His plan was to try to find some way to discover if the council, or anyone, knew when the trouble would arrive. If he could figure out what was coming and when, he may be able to convince someone to help him stop it.
Sapphire had pointed out that a lot of people inside Aurâin kept track of what was going on in the world, and Xion just needed a way to learn what they knew. He and Ava had agreed to be the ones who went looking for that information.
During the day, the four of them went about business as usual. They went to weapons training, where Xion was finally managing to hold his own with a sword. This, of course, prompted Gillan to introduce fighting with a shield and sword at the same time, setting Xion further back. Training with Yarlain was much better. After she was satisfied that he had mastered levitating small objects, she moved on to other spells. She taught him a spell for making a small object give off light, which he mastered in only three sessions. Then, she taught him how to conjure a small flame in the palm of his hand. She explained that it was a battle spell, and the flame could be thrown, but he should never use it inside Aurâin. That one took him almost two weeks to master.
After classes, Xion and the others would meet in the library. It was a large building near the center of town, and unlike all the other buildings he had been to so far, it was not sectioned off into rooms with staircases hidden in the corners.
